I posted something about rainwater harvesting a couple of days ago. In one of the posts I included the phrase "my family". When I viewed the post a day later I found that the phrase "my family" had become a hyperlink to a website selling stuff. In fact the website changes everytime I click on it, the second time it linked through to a foreign hotel chain. Is there a bug on this website or are you sponsored by someone?

It could be that the forum has something like skimlinks working as an affiliate programme. Or it could be something on your end, a browser add-in that you may have unwittingly picked up. I don't see these, so perhaps it's your end.

Check which browser extensions/add-ins you have running and see if disabling them removes the links.

Run HitmanPro or your preferred malware scanner.

Aha, I'm using Firefox and there was an addon enabled which converts useful phrases to links. So it was at my end, mea culpa and all that. Now I've got to find out who installed it!
